计算机VB学习.pptVIP

  1. 1、本文档共36页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
计算机VB学习

Visual Basic 程 序 设 计 7.1 数组的概念 数组:数组是有序数据的集合。一般数组中的所有元素具有相同的数据类型(在VB 中,一个数组的元素类型可以不同)。 数组中的每一元素具有唯一索引号(即下标),可以用数组名及下标唯一地识别一个数组的元素,如:A(2)。 说明:数组必须先声明后使用;声明一个数组就是声明 其数组名、类型、维数和数组的大小。 数组的维数(下标的个数)各维下标之间用逗号分开。 在VB中有一维数组、二维数组…最多可以达到60维 数组的声明语法是: [Dim/Private/Public] 数组名([下界To]上界,…) [As 数据类型] 数组元素的表示方法如下: 数组名( s1 , s2··· ) 其中:s1,s2表示该元素在数组中的排列位置,称为“下标”。 数组的分类: 全局的(应用程序级) 模块级的--- Private | Dim 数组名(n) [As 类型名] 局部的(过程级)--Static | Dim 数组名(n) [As 类型名] 注意:全局数组必须在标准模块的声明段中,用 Public声 明,即:Public 数组名(n) [As 类型名] 不能在窗体模块和类模块中声明全局数组 例如:Dim Counter(1TO 14) As Integer ‘14个元素的局部数组   Private Sume (1 TO 20) As Double ‘20个元素的模块级数组 Option Base 语句 如果用户不显式地使用To关键字声明下界,则VB 默认下界为0。 注意:数组的上界必须大于等于下界而且不得 超过Long数据的范围。 option base 语句的格式、功能: 格式:option base [0 | 1] 功能:用来声明数组下标的缺省下界 (在模块的声明段中使用) 如:在窗体或标准模块中将数组下标的 缺省下界设置为1。 option base 1 关于数组声明的几点说明: ① 数组名的命名规则和变量名的相同,其下标一 定要用()括起来,且下界必须小于其上界。 ② 在同一个过程中,数组名不能与变量名重名, 否则会出错。 ③ 在定义数组时,每一维的元素个数必须是常数, 不能是变量或表达式。 (已赋值的变量,也是错误的)。   ④ 若声明数组时未指明其类型,则该数组为变体 数组,变体数组的元素类型可以不同。 例题7.1:变体数组举例 li7_1.vbp 7.2 一维数组的声明与应用 数组声明时,数组的大小固定的数组称为静态数组。 它指明了数组的维数和每一维的下标范围,在使用过程中,它的维数和下标范围将不得改变。 数组声明的形式为: [Public| Static| Dim] 数组名(维数定义) [As 数据类型] 如:Static A(10) AS Integer ‘一维整形数组 Dim stu(50,4) As String ‘二维字符串数组 Dim defarra(1 to 5) ‘一维变体数组 例题7.2 :变体数组举例 li7_2.vbp 给数组元素赋初值 可以使用循环结构和Array函数给数组赋初值。 (1)使用循环结构 如给数组strMark(100)的元素赋初值: For i = 1 To 100 strMark(i) = 0 Next (2)使用Array 函数 Array 函数用来为数组元素赋值,即把一个数据集读入某个数组,其语法格式为: 变量名 = Array(数据列表) 如: Option Base 1 Private Sub Command1_Click() Static Test_str ‘ 声明一个静态的变体变量

文档评论(0)

phltaotao +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档